Clean Transportation Program: Protecting Electric Vehicle Charging Stations
This law adds protection against vandalism for public electric vehicle (EV) charging stations to the list of eligible programs and projects under the Clean Transportation Program in California.
What This Bill Does
- Adds programs and projects that protect EV charging stations from damage or theft to the list of things that can get funding under the Clean Transportation Program.
Who It Names or Affects
- The State Energy Resources Conservation and Development Commission
- Entities that develop and deploy technologies related to clean transportation in California
Terms To Know
- Clean Transportation Program
- A program funded by the state of California to support projects that help reduce pollution from vehicles.
- Alternative and Renewable Fuel and Vehicle Technology Fund
- A fund used by the State Energy Resources Conservation and Development Commission to pay for programs under the Clean Transportation Program.
Limits and Unknowns
- The bill does not specify how much money will be allocated for these new projects.
- It is unclear which specific entities or organizations will receive funding from this program.
